By the end of 2024, the total scale of CeFi loans will be $11.2 billion

Bitget2025/04/15 02:06

According to a report by Jinse Finance, Alex Thorn, head of research at Galaxy Digital, stated in a post on X that based on the review of public documents, bankruptcy filings, and voluntary disclosures from active lenders, the total scale of centralized finance (CeFi) loans is projected to be $11.2 billion by the end of 2024, down 68% from the historical peak (ATH) of $34.8 billion in 2022.

By the end of 2024, based on outstanding loan book size, the largest CeFi lenders will be: Tether, Galaxy, Ledn, Maple, Unchained, Centrifuge, Goldfinch, Arch and TrueFi. While DeFi is relatively transparent, CeFi lending is much less so. However, combined together with an outstanding loan market size estimated at around $30 billion. Currently, the outstanding loan market size for DeFi has surpassed that of CeFi. If we also include collateralized debt position (CDP) stablecoins like DAI , it would exceed $35 billion. In fact , DeFi currently accounts for more than 60% of the cryptocurrency lending market.

S&P expects SK Hynix to launch another maximum 40 trillion won buyback in the fourth quarter, coupled with generous dividends, providing new catalysts for Korea's Value-up market trend.

S&P Global Market Intelligence predicts that SK Hynix may announce a new stock buyback plan worth between 20 trillion and 40 trillion Korean won in the fourth quarter of this year. This news pushed its ADR to surge more than 6% on Tuesday, and its Korean stock price once jumped 5% on Wednesday. S&P noted that, alongside Samsung Electronics’ cancellation of treasury stocks and large-scale dividends, these two giants are expected to set a new benchmark for corporate governance in the Korean capital market, helping to resolve the long-standing "Korea discount" dilemma.
